The man was pronounced dead at the scene
A man has died following a motorcycle crash in Co. Offaly.
The incident happened last night at Mullaghatour in Belmont at around 6.45pm.
The motorcyclist, a man in his 40s, was pronounced dead at the scene.
The road remains closed this morning as Forensic Collision Investigators carry out a technical examination.
Gardaí are appealing for witnesses to the single vehicle collision to come forward.
